Another important aspect to consider is the type of insulation used. Foam and vacuum insulation panels are both available, but choosing the right option depends on your particular requirements. Foam is more cost-effective while vacuum has superior thermal resistance.

Other innovations include airflow vents or fresh air ducts that manage the interior atmosphere and keep it stable. These piping systems remove gases such as ethylene, which accelerates the ripening process in fruits. They also ensure even distribution of temperatures across all areas of the container. In addition an integrated drainage system helps prevent the accumulation of water and insect infestation.

Refrigeration systems are essential to maintain the quality of cargo, however they can also use up a lot of energy. This is especially the case when there are multiple containers stored on the same container vessel or at an airport terminal. This power-intensive use is offset by refrigerators with automated temperature control systems. These systems are designed to monitor and adjust the temperature of the container based on its surroundings which results in significant energy savings.
Modern refrigerated containers (reefers), which are designed to be energy efficient, make use of advanced cooling and insulation technology to reduce the power consumption. They are often also equipped with diesel generators which can be used even in locations that do not have electricity. This enables them to operate during travel or even when stationary power isn't available.
A large share of the electricity consumption of refrigerated containers for sale uk can be attributed by heat exchange between container interior and environment through insulation that is cold-resistant. Its proportion ranges from 35 to 85% when cooling and can reach 50% when heating (Filina & Filin, 2004).

Cooling
Airflow systems are used in refrigerators to distribute cold air through the container, keeping the cargo at a proper temperature. This helps to remove the gases, moisture, and ethylene that are produced by fruits and veggies, which can lead to spoilage.
It is essential to inspect regularly the insulated piping in reefers to ensure that there is no leakage. By using an halide and soap lamp or electronic leak detector can assist in determining the source of any issue. Also, it's a good idea to periodically look for any signs of ice accumulation on the inside of the refrigeration unit. This can have a negative impact on the capacity of the container's cooling.
Compressors are a major component in the cooling process. They are responsible for pressingurizing the refrigerant and circulating it within the refrigeration system. Conducting regular calibrations of the compressor can increase efficiency and decrease the energy consumption.
Insulation is another important component of special reefer containers, as it minimizes heat transfer between the exterior and interior. To maximize the efficiency of thermal energy and to ensure constant temperatures throughout the shipping process, high-quality insulation materials like polyurethane is used.
